Merry Christmas... Merry Christmas... are the words which makes us happy by wishing to others or by receiving. The hero of the festival is Santa Claus who make every child's dream come true. The gifts he give reach almost all kids of the world. As he was about to start his journey from north pole his sledge got stuck in the snow. Help him escape from there and start his good deed.
©2005-2024 FLASH512. COST: 0.075s Feedback